New York student Bruce Cadogan learns of the legendary tango singer Julio Martel while working on his PhD thesis about Borges and the origins of the tango, and embarks upon a fascinating trip to Buenos Aires in search of him.
Using a combination of live action, archival films and still photos presents a biography of Anderson, a gifted contralto who became internationally recognized despire many opportunities denied her as an African American.
Celebrate the life, career and musical legacy of Anderson whose character and talent made enormous contributions to the course of civil rights. Hear her reminisce about the people and events that shaped her personal and musical development.
Poet, rapper, and singer-songwriter, K'naan, recounts his story, in which, he and his family were in danger and fled his home in Somali to live in New York and eventually found a home in Canada.
